Transaction 2d77908456d33aba1d6bc81b7dc14e1f3a55f943353287ed09f68cd5c106a260
1 Input
1 Output
-
2d77908456d33aba1d6bc81b7dc14e1f3a55f943353287ed09f68cd5c106a260:0
- value
- 664400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 220a2510ee96d56f983500659c3df9150d80cfcc OP_EQUALVERIFY OP_CHECKSIG
- address
- 146z8PtM51KTUnxjGGf9DsGBxngxfSFBUB